Case 439/2025 Summary: Respondent Madhu P M pleaded guilty to offences under Section 15(c) read with Section 63 of the Abkari Act. The court convicted the accused and sentenced them to pay a fine of Rs. 800, with an alternate sentence of 10 days simple imprisonment in case of non-payment.
